Elias Conklin was born in 1758 in Haverstraw, Rockland County, New York, United States of America, the child of Joshua Conklin And Elizabeth Van Ditman. Elias Conklin married Celette Charlotte Helm, and had children including Elias Conklin, Elinor Conklin, Elizabeth Conklin, Hannah Conklin, Jacob Conklin, John Conklin, Permelia Conklin, Samuel Conklin. Elias Conklin passed away in 1839 in Conklin, Broome County, New York, United States of America.
